This page covers the environments affected by the session-token refresh bug tracked for the Larkspur release. The bug only reproduces in environments where token lifetimes are shorter than the refresh poll interval, which currently means staging and the Vexbury canary. Prod is unaffected because its lifetimes were extended last quarter. Before approving the release, confirm the fix has been verified in both affected environments. For reference, the staging environment currently runs with the following configuration values.

settings of tagef-bawif:
DRUIX_HOST=druix.zemvarlabs.internal
DRUIX_PORT=8000

### Account Recovery — Catalogue Import (Lintwood)

Quick one for review: when the Lintwood catalogue import wipes a patron's session table, the recovery flow re-seeds accounts from the nightly snapshot. Check that the importer skips locked accounts — last time it didn't. To rerun recovery against staging you'll need the vault passphrase, which is appended just below.

recovery phrase for yafof-tajof: julmir-kelax-julvan-holath-belvan-holir-ralael-ralvan-ralath-julvan-silmir-istmir-kaswyn-ulamir

## Deployment

The legacy Quillbase ORM layer is being replaced by the Tressel data mapper. Both paths run in parallel behind a flag; writes go through Tressel, reads fall back to Quillbase on mismatch. Deploy order: migrate schema shims, flip the read flag, then retire the old connection pool. Rollback is flag-only — do not revert the schema. If pages fire on mismatch rates above 2%, flip the flag back first. Current service configuration follows.

service settings:
HOLDOR_PIN=6477
HOLDOR_METRICS_HOST=metrics.holdor.nelvrocorp.corp
HOLDOR_LOG_LEVEL=error
HOLDOR_TENANT=noviel

## Configuration

Canary deploys in the Orvex platform are gated by rules in canary-gates.yaml: error-rate under 1%, latency p95 under 300ms, minimum 10 minutes of soak. New team members should not edit gate thresholds without a review from the release channel. The gate evaluator pulls metrics from the Thrume telemetry service and needs a credential in .env.canary, placed on the following line.

vault entry, yahif-yajep: COURIER_KEY29=b802bdf8034096b65a51c6ba5abe2